摘要

A combination of controllers known as the Flexible AC Transmission System (FACTS) technology can be used independently or in conjunction with one another to control one or more of the interconnected system parameters. Series impedance, shunt impedance, current, voltage, and phase angle can all be controlled by FACTS controllers. These controllers either use self-commutated inverters as synchronous voltage sources to change the current transmission line voltage and so manage the power flow, or they use thyristor-switched capacitors and reactors to provide reactive shunt and series compensation. The primary goal of this paper is to go through the Interline Power Flow controller's fundamental features. The Basic Interline Power Flow Controller and several IPFC setups are simulated in this work. The simulation of IPFC is developed by using the ORCAD PSPICE, package.
